John's brothers' Josiah and Martin where in Indiana at the time John and
the family moved there. Martin also only had two son's as documented in
the "Samuel Chapman Book" by Ira Allen Chapman. The first was Martin,
Jr. the second was Erastus Otis. Martin Jr. married in 1849 in IN and
had nine children, two sons Melvin and Thomas. Erastus married about
the same time but had no children. By the way, Martin and Greenup are
definitely two separate people, they are brothers Martin being born
18-Dec-1794 and Greenup born 1806 lived and died in Scioto Co, OH where
as Martin moved to IN. I had previously posted information as Martin
"Greenup" which was in error sorry.

Paul Rekow recently send me an update on his descendents of James
Chapman
of Amelia Co., VA.
James son John (b.1791 VA) had a son Albert (b. 1819 Scioto Co., OH)
who had a son William b. November 11, 1842 location unknown. Acording to
Paul, William died in the civil war March 25, 1865 in Petersburg, VA.
Unknown as yet where Albert was when he died or where the William, his 3
sisters and brother John were born. Maybe Paul can add to the discussion.
